

Get ready, Purcellville! The Loudoun Youth Battle of the Bands is making its way to our town for Round Two, scheduled to take place at the iconic Bush Tabernacle Skating Rink on Friday, January 9, 2026 at 6pm. This exciting event invites local middle and high school musicians to showcase their incredible talents in a competitive atmosphere, with the chance to advance to the grand finale.
Loudoun Youth, Inc. is calling all aspiring musicians to participate in this year’s Battle of the Bands, featuring three qualifying rounds followed by a thrilling grand final. Artists will have the opportunity to win professional recording sessions, cash prizes, and valuable mentorship from industry professionals.

Following Round Two, Round Three will take place on February 13 at Cascades Overlook Event Center in Sterling, with the monumental final showdown scheduled for March 6 at Tally Ho in Leesburg.
How It Works
Ten artists will compete at each of the first three battles, with the top four finishers—first place, second place, fan favorite, and soloist winner—advancing to the grand final. This format accommodates a variety of musical styles and performance types, allowing bands to compete as full groups or as solo artists, vocalists, instrumentalists, or DJs/producers.
Participants will be competing for impressive rewards, starting with first place, which earns a full-day recording session with Blue Room Productions, a $500 cash prize from Loudoun Youth, Inc., and a professional photo session. Second place will receive a half-day recording session, $300 in cash, and photography services. The soloist winner gains a full-day recording session, $200 in cash, and professional photography, while all competitors will also compete for the best original song award and fan favorite recognition.
Tickets for Battles I-III are $8 online and $10 at the door, while final battle tickets are $10 online and $12 at the door.Round Two promises to be an unforgettable evening of music and camaraderie, showcasing the vibrant talent of our local youth.
